    Drilling Superintendent

    Job & Main Specifications (Education/Knowledge, Skills, Attributes, Experience & Other Required Details)

    • Must be a professional engineer with a degree or qualification in a relevant engineering or science discipline.
    • Must have a minimum of 15 years of experience in Drilling and Completion Operations or Engineering, in Nigeria, with exposure to contractors. Ideally in a position of Drilling Superintendent or Operations Drilling Engineer.
    • Must have good communication and writing skills, with PC fluency.
    • Must be proficient in English, both in speech and in writing.
    • Must have a deep knowledge of local drilling market and practices in Nigeria.
    • Must be able to work autonomously and take initiatives when required.
    • Must be willing to provide on-call 24/7 hour coverage during operations.
    • Duties & Responsibilities include, but may not be limited to
    • Responsible for rig market survey, rig performance and track-record evaluation, on site visits to evaluate rigs available on the domestic market.
    • Be part of the contractor selection for drilling and completion. Assist in the preparation of tenders, bid evaluation, award of contracts of all drilling and completion related services. Conduct operational analysis and write up reports in relation with various tendering processes.
    • In charge of interactions with local vendors involved in the drilling campaign or with international vendors when they operate in Nigeria.
    • Liaises with contractors to ensure that high quality services and equipment are provided in accordance with contracts.
    • Liaises with Nigerian authorities to support submitting well-related notifications and obtaining permits relating to drilling operations.
    • Schedule and co-ordinate all resources during the drilling preparation phase, including personnel, equipment, and materials, to ensure that drilling operations are adequately supported and that projects stay within budget..
    • Responsible for delivery follow-up of long-lead items purchased (inventory, quality and conformity check, monitoring of adequate storage).
    • Organizes the logistics/expedites materials and equipment to the rig.
    • Ensure that the site preparation is done in accordance with the objectives set and the Company approved operational practices and procedures.
    • Oversee quality control measures to ensure that the drilling process meets quality and performance standards.
    • Troubleshoot complex challenges during drilling operations. Quickly identify and address issues to prevent delays and ensure project success.
    • Maintain detailed records of drilling activities, safety protocols, and performance metrics.
    • Implement safety and environmental policies at the early phase of drilling project.
    • Monitor the HSE, operational, commercial and technical performance of the rig and contractors under his control measure the quality of the products and services and formulate routes for improvement.
    • Observe all Company HSE instructions, act in a safe manner and avoid unnecessary risks to themselves and others.
    • Immediately report any unsafe conditions or activities and dangerous occurrences.
